Situated on the Carse of Stirling, near the picturesque village of Kippen, yet within easy reach of Stirling, Loch Lomond National Park, Glasgow and Edinburgh, they provide the perfect touring base. Fordhead and The Fords o' Frew are an important location historically and have provided such notables as William Wallace, Bonnie Prince Charlie and Rob Roy MacGregor with the only relatively safe crossing point over the River Forth upstream from Stirling over the years.
